Abstract

The disclosed radiograph acquisition device has: a selection unit that selects one radiation detection device from among a plurality of radiation detection devices that can convert radiation to radiographs; and an acquisition unit that acquires the radiograph of one radiation detection device when radiation is radiated at a subject, and the radiograph of at least one other radiation detection device aside from the one radiation device among the plurality of radiation detection devices.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A radiographic image capturing system comprising:
 a plurality of radiographic image capturing apparatus that are disposed in one image capturing chamber and are used for capturing images of a subject in a supine position or an upright position, a radiation source which outputs radiation based on an image capturing condition being shared by said plurality of image capturing apparatuses and being movable towards the subject, said plurality of radiographic image capturing apparatuses including 
 respective radiation detecting devices each of which is placed on or in an image capturing base and converts the radiation having passed through the subject into a radiographic image; and 
 a radiographic image acquiring apparatus including 
 a selector configured to select one radiation detecting device of one radiographic image capturing apparatus from among the radiation detecting devices of the plurality of radiographic image capturing apparatus, 
 an acquirer configured to acquire, based on an image capturing condition for the one radiation detecting device, a radiographic image from the one radiation detecting device and a radiographic image from another radiation detecting device which is at least one different radiation detecting device of another radiographic image capturing apparatus that differs from the one radiation detecting device, from among the radiation detecting devices of the plurality of radiographic image capturing apparatus, in a case that a subject is irradiated with the radiation, 
 a judging section configured to judge whether or not the radiographic image from the one radiation detecting device is a significant radiographic image representative of the subject and judge whether or not the radiographic image from another radiation detecting device is a significant radiographic image in a case that the radiographic image from the one radiation detecting device is not a significant radiographic image, wherein the judging includes obtaining a significance value of a radiographic image and determining whether the significance value indicates that the radiographic image is representative of the subject, and 
 a switcher configured to switch from the image capturing condition for the one radiation detecting device to an image capturing condition for the different detecting device, if the judging section judges that the radiographic image from the different radiation detecting device is the significant radiographic image. 
 
     
     
       2.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 an indicating unit for externally indicating a judgment result from the judging section, if the judging section judges that the radiographic image from the one radiation detecting device is not the significant radiographic image. 
 
     
     
       3.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the judging section judges whether or not the radiographic image from the other radiation detecting device is the significant radiographic image, if the judging section judges that the radiographic image from the one radiation detecting device is not the significant radiographic image. 
     
     
       4.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the acquirer successively acquires radiographic images from other radiation detecting devices until the judging section has found the significant radiographic image, if the judging section judges that the radiographic image from the one radiation detecting device is not the significant radiographic image. 
     
     
       5.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 4 , wherein the selector selects the one radiation detecting device, and designates an imaging method to be carried out upon application of radiation to the subject using the one radiation detecting device; and
 the acquirer acquires a radiographic image preferentially from a radiation detecting device, from among the other radiation detecting devices, which produces a radiographic image according to the imaging method, or acquires a radiographic image preferentially from another radiation detecting device that is in close proximity to the one radiation detecting device. 
 
     
     
       6.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 an output unit for externally outputting the radiographic image which the judging section has judged as being the significant radiographic image. 
 
     
     
       7.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ein in a case that the radiation is applied to the subject in an image capturing chamber, the acquirer acquires the radiographic image from the one radiation detecting device and the radiographic image from the other radiation detecting device, which also is present in the image capturing chamber, from among the plurality of radiation detecting devices. 
     
     
       8.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 an identification information storage unit for storing identification information of the plurality of radiation detecting devices that are present in the image capturing chamber in a case that the radiation is applied to the subject in the image capturing chamber, 
 wherein the acquirer acquires radiographic images from the plurality of radiation detecting devices that are present in the image capturing chamber based on the identification information stored in the identification information storage unit. 
 
     
     
       9. The radiographic image acquiring ap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the radiation detecting devices comprises a radiation conversion panel for converting the radiation into electric charges, storing the electric charges, and outputting the stored electric charges as an electric signal to an external device, and the radiation conversion panel is made ready to store the electric charges before the radiation is applied to the subject.
